After Thanksgiving Visits
US reports more than 3,000 corona deaths in one day

At the end of November, many American citizens were out and about to celebrate Thanksgiving, as usual. Two weeks later, authorities now report 3,000 more deaths in Corona. More than ever in a day.

The number of daily deaths per crown in the US has reached a new high of more than 3,000. On Wednesday, there were another 3,011 deaths from the pandemic, according to figures from the New York Times. In addition, 218,000 new infections were recorded in one day. In California alone, the most populous of the 50 US states, there were more than 26,000 new infections in one day.

The number of Covid 19 patients in hospitals also hit a new record: on Wednesday there were more than 106,000 patients. The surge in cases was expected after millions of people ignored Thanksgiving calls two weeks ago to avoid trips and family visits.

The United States is numerically the country most affected by the corona pandemic in the entire world. Since the pandemic began, more than 15 million coronavirus infections have been detected in the United States and more than 289,000 people have died.

The new corona vaccines are now giving hope. On Thursday, the FDA’s vaccination commission is examining the application for emergency approval of the corona vaccine from Mainz-based company Biontech and its US partner Pfizer. If the independent vaccination commission votes in favor of an emergency approval, the FDA could issue it very quickly. The FDA said Tuesday that it classified the vaccine as safe and effective.

On Thursday next week, the US vaccination committee will deal with the request for emergency approval for the vaccine from the US pharmaceutical company Moderna.
